Explain oxidation number with rules. Calculate oxidation number of Cr in Cr₂O₇²⁻.

Rules:·         O = –2, H = +1, element in free state = 0·         Sum of oxidation numbers = charge on speciesIn Cr₂O₇²⁻: Let oxidation number of Cr = x2x+7(–2)=–2⇒2x–14=–2⇒x=+6 So, Cr = +6

State the First Law of Thermodynamics

Energy can neither be created nor destroyed, only transformed. ΔU=q+w
